Corn Prices Spike Above $5 as Crop Tour Reveals Disappointing Yields

Corn futures prices surged to their highest level since May at $5.03 3/4, driven by disappointing findings from the Midwest Crop Tour, according to market analyst Ted Seifried.

The tour's scouts reported down significantly lower corn yields in most states, including South Dakota, Ohio, Nebraska, and Indiana, with Illinois posting a seven-year low for the tour. This is 'not anywhere near what the USDA is expecting', Seifried said.

The rally is not just about production, but also due to increased demand for exports, as the USDA's August World Agricultural Supply and Demand Estimates report showed an additional 1.4 million corn acres and lowered yield to 180.7 bushels per acre nationally. New-crop exports rose 75 million bushels before the marketing year has even begun, which Seifried called 'unusual'. He linked this demand increase to concerns about a potential Super El Nino disrupting South American fertilizer supply and planting.

Despite the bullish fundamentals, Seifried urged caution on chasing the rally into September, pointing out that corn often puts in its highs in August even in supply-short years. With a large volume of old-crop corn from last year's 17-billion-bushel harvest still needing to move, he expects natural selling pressure in the weeks ahead.
